Michel de Montaigne’s ‘Essays – Deutsche Ausgabe’ offers readers a unique and introspective look into the mind of one of the greatest French Renaissance writers. The collection of essays covers a wide range of topics including philosophy, literature, education, and personal reflections. Montaigne’s literary style is characterized by its conversational tone, combining intellectual rigor with personal anecdotes, making the essays both accessible and thought-provoking. Written in the 16th century, these essays are considered as one of the earliest examples of the modern essay form, influencing generations of writers to come.
